Obudu Records 80 Percent Coverage In Immunisation


Obudu (Cross River) - The Obudu Local Government in Cross River has recorded more 80 per cent coverage in the ongoing national immunisation programme, the Chairman, Mr. Justine Ugbe, said in Obudu.


Ugbe said the council’s performance in the area of immunisation in the last six months was commendable.


Ugbe told newsmen “We recorded the lowest performance in immunisation coverage in the state and now we are able to reverse that.


“We embarked on mass enlightenment campaign to re-orientate the people on healthy living as well as collaborate with health bodies to immunise children and women in the area.


Ugbe said his administration had introduced some incentives for health officials as part of the strategies of ensuring success of the programme.


“I am happy that our modest efforts have begun to yield dividends with the local government emerging in recent survey among the top six local governments in the state in immunisation coverage ,”he said.


The Chairman said the council embarked on the rehabilitation of some boreholes while new ones would be provided to rid the area of water-borne diseases.


“To address this unwholesome situation, council collaborated with the state Rural Water Sanitation Agency (RUWATSSA) and a technical team from the Tulsi Chiarai Foundation”. Ugbe said.
